LOT252 TO LOT344 FROM COLLECTION OF ITALIAN DIPLOMAT GIUSEPPE ROS 1883-1948.

Giuseppe Ros (1883-1948) was born in Naples, Italy on August 12th 1883. His ancestors came from Spain in the second half of the 18th century. After graduating from the Oriental Department of the University of Naples, in the early years he worked in the Civil Engineering Bureau. In March 1908, he passed the interpreter exam of the ministry of foreign affairs. In 1910 He was sent to Shanghai, where he kept close contact with Qimei Chen, an important role of the Qingbang. From 1921 to 1925, he was consul in Hankou and then in Beiping. In 1926 he was appointed as the Italian representative of the International Commission for the study of extraterritorial rights of China, and in 1931, he was the Italian member of the military and civilian commission for the surveillance of the China-Japanese armistice in Shanghai. At the end of 1936 he was sent to Guangzhou as consul general and promoted to consul general in 1942. He retired from the foreign office in 1946 and died of illness on 18th June 1948.

Part of his collection of Chinese porcelain and calligraphy works will be auctioned, including some porcelain from the internal affairs office of the last Qing Dynasty to thank him for sending Italian fire brigade to help put out a fire in Jianfu Palace on June 26th, 1923. The China is accompanied by a special purchase letter and mark dated June 27th from the Ministry of the Interior.

According to the Republic of China "Declaration" reported; "At eleven o'clock in the night, the room Shenwu gate in the west, Jianfu Palace, the fire was burning for about half an hour when they English teacher Johnston arrived, busy to call the Italian legation, the fire brigade into rescue. "Seven or eight Italian fire fighters, men and women, came in through the Donghua gate with their firefighting machines and sprayed the fire. Fortunately, the machine was so excellent that the water line was like a waterfall, so the fire was gradually reduced and the fire was not in danger of spreading until six o'clock after sunrise."

The calligraphy and painting collection was purchased by his wife Rose from WenZhenZhai painting and calligraphy shop in Peiping colored glaze Factory, and each piece of painting and calligraphy has the identification mark of "WenZhenZhai Examination Seal", which was very clear. WenZhanZhai was founded in the 32nd year of Guangxu Dynasty and opened for more than 40 years, identifying and dealing in calligraphy, painting, porcelain and other antiquities. Its Feng Zhanru participated in the acquisition of Sui Dynasty painter Zhan Ziqian's "Spring Tour".
